WebDec 14, 2024 · An example of a fixed cost for Mr. Shute's business is the monthly rent he pays on his manufacturing facility. The amount he pays would be the same whether he manufactured ten doors or 10,000... WebApr 4, 2024 · The following are the characteristics of marginal costing: (1) Classification of costs: All costs are classified as fixed and variable costs. (2) Focus on variable costs: Fixed costs are constant. They do not fluctuate with output. By contrast, variable costs always go up or down with the output, while the per unit cost remains the same.

Period cost. expense in period on the income statement. -all selling and administrative costs. Period cost examples. sales commissions, property taxes on corporate headquarters. Cost classification for predicting cost behavior: (4) -variable cost. -fixed cost.
